Background
Function FUNCTION: Catalyzes the first and rate limiting step of the catabolism of the essential amino acid tryptophan along the kynurenine pathway (PubMed:17671174). Involved in immune regulation. May not play a significant role in tryptophan-related tumoral resistance (PubMed:25691885). {ECO:0000269|PubMed:17671174, ECO:0000303|PubMed:25691885}.
Pathway Amino-acid degradation; L-tryptophan degradation via kynurenine pathway; L-kynurenine from L-tryptophan: step 1/2.
Protein Families Indoleamine 2,3-dioxygenase family
Tissue Specificity Detected in liver, small intestine, spleen, placenta, thymus, lung, brain, kidney, and colon (PubMed:17671174). Also expressed at low level in testis and thyroid. Not expressed in the majority of human tumor samples (>99%) (PubMed:25691885). {ECO:0000269|PubMed:17671174, ECO:0000303|PubMed:25691885}.
